Abstract

The employee candidate selection process in many companies is still often carried out manually, resulting in decision-making that is subjective, inconsistent, and ineffective, especially when having to evaluate many applicants based on various criteria simultaneously. This situation makes it difficult for companies to determine the best candidate objectively and accurately. Therefore, this study aims to develop a Decision Support System (DSS) in the selection of new employee candidates by combining the MEREC (Method based on the Removal Effects of Criteria) and TOPSIS (Technique for Order Preference by Similarity to Ideal Solution) methods. The MEREC method is used to determine the weight of criteria objectively based on the influence of each criterion on the change in alternative performance, while the TOPSIS method is used to rank prospective employees based on their closeness to the positive ideal solution and their distance from the negative ideal solution. The criteria used in this study include education, work experience, technical skills, communication, and age. The results of the study indicate that the proposed method combination is able to produce a more objective, systematic, and accurate employee selection process. Based on the ranking results, alternative A7-IP obtained the highest preference value of 0.9945 and ranked first, followed by A5-EK with a value of 0.9427 in second place, and A1-AR with a value of 0.8946 in third place. The application of the MEREC and TOPSIS methods also successfully increased consistency and reduced subjectivity in the employee selection decision-making process.
